Origins and Importance

bio_ik originated from the need for a more versatile and efficient IK solver capable of handling the intricate demands of modern robotics. Developed by the TAMS Group, this project aims to provide a robust, flexible, and high-performance IK solution. Its importance lies in its ability to significantly enhance robot manipulation, making it indispensable for applications ranging from industrial automation to humanoid robots.

Core Features and Implementation

bio_ik boasts several core features that set it apart:

  1. Customizable Constraints: Unlike traditional IK solvers, bio_ik allows users to define custom constraints, enabling more precise and context-specific motion planning. This is achieved through a flexible API that supports various types of constraints, such as joint limits, collision avoidance, and target orientation.

  2. Efficient Optimization Algorithms: The project employs state-of-the-art optimization techniques to ensure rapid and accurate solution finding. These algorithms are designed to minimize computational overhead, making bio_ik suitable for real-time applications.

  3. Scalability and Modularity: bio_ik is built with scalability in mind. Its modular architecture allows for easy integration with different robotic systems and platforms, making it a versatile tool for a wide range of applications.

  4. Parallel Processing Support: To further enhance performance, bio_ik leverages parallel processing capabilities, enabling simultaneous computation of multiple IK solutions. This is particularly beneficial in complex scenarios where multiple constraints need to be satisfied.

Real-World Applications

One notable application of bio_ik is in the field of industrial robotics. In a manufacturing setting, bio_ik has been used to optimize the motion of robotic arms, reducing cycle times and improving precision. For instance, a robotic arm equipped with bio_ik can efficiently navigate around obstacles and perform complex tasks such as assembly and welding with high accuracy.
